Incense, licorice and a host of other dark aromas and flavors emerge as the 2008 Saia (Nero d’Avola) opens up in the glass. The 2008 is more complex and nuanced than the 2009, but also firmer in style. Mint, tobacco and anise are some of the notes that develop over time. This striking, beautifully delineated red should continue to provide compelling drinking for a number of years. It is yet another example of a great Italian wine that over delivers for the money. Anticipated maturity: 2013-2020.
Feudo Maccari is located in Noto, one of the regions within Sicily where Nero d’Avola excels.
